7Devs
IOS Developer (SwiftUI)
7DevsUkraine5 days ago
Full-timeRemote FriendlyEngineering, Information Technology

About the Company


7Devs is a cozy and modern IT outsourcing company founded by a team of tech enthusiasts who value clean code, elegant design, and meaningful work. We create high-quality web and mobile solutions for clients across Europe, the USA, and Canada. What sets us apart? Our startup spirit, flexible remote work culture, and deep respect for each team member. We don’t just follow trends – we set them.



About the Role


We are looking for a curious and motivated iOS Engineer to join our team at 7Devs.



Responsibilities


  • Develop and maintain iOS features using SwiftUI, Combine, and modern architectural patterns (MVVMC)
  • Integrate GraphQL APIs via Apollo
  • Work with AWS (S3, Amplify) and Firebase services
  • Implement in-app purchases with StoreKit / RevenueCat
  • Collaborate on real-time functionality using WebSockets
  • Help enhance the app’s media capabilities via AVFoundation
  • Participate in feature planning, code reviews, and technical discussions



Qualifications


  • +2 years in commercial iOS development
  • Proven proficiency in developing native mobile applications for iOS (Swift), primarily.
  • Strong understanding of mobile design patterns, performance optimization, and distributed systems.
  • Familiarity with modern mobile analytics and backend integration (Websockets and GraphQL) for real-time functionality.
  • Deep understanding of Apple Human Interface Guidelines.
  • English at B1+ level (both written and spoken)
  • Excellent command of the Ukrainian language (C1 level or higher)


Required Skills


  • Proficiency in Swift and iOS development
  • Experience with SwiftUI and Combine
  • Knowledge of GraphQL and Apollo
  • Familiarity with AWS and Firebase
  • Understanding of in-app purchases and StoreKit


Preferred Skills


  • Experience with AVFoundation
  • Knowledge of WebSockets
  • Experience in code reviews and technical discussions


Pay range and compensation package


We offer a flexible remote work environment, a friendly and collaborative team, challenging and meaningful projects, and opportunities to grow.

Key Skills

Ranked by relevance